Understanding Walk-In Humidity Chambers Walk-in humidity chambers are large, enclosed spaces that maintain specific temperature and humidity levels, allowing for comprehensive testing of products. They are widely used in sectors such as pharmaceuticals, food and beverage, electronics, and materials science. The primary functions of these chambers include: Environmental Testing: Simulating various climate conditions to evaluate how products respond to humidity and temperature changes. Stability Testing: Assessing the shelf-life and stability of products, especially in the pharmaceutical and food sectors. Quality Control: Ensuring products meet regulatory standards and quality benchmarks before market release. These chambers can be customized to meet specific testing requirements, accommodating a wide range of products, from small electronic components to large industrial machinery. 2. Key Industries Utilizing Walk-In Humidity Chambers Walk-in humidity chambers find applications across a range of industries, each with unique requirements and challenges: Pharmaceuticals: Stability testing is critical for ensuring that drugs maintain their efficacy over time. Humidity chambers help pharmaceutical companies conduct accelerated stability studies and shelf-life testing. Food and Beverage: Ensuring the quality and safety of food products is paramount. Walk-in humidity chambers allow manufacturers to test how humidity levels affect food preservation, packaging materials, and shelf life. Electronics: As electronic devices become more complex, manufacturers must test their durability under various environmental conditions. Humidity chambers help assess the impact of moisture on electronic components, ensuring product reliability. Materials Science: Researchers use humidity chambers to study the properties of materials under different environmental conditions, aiding in the development of new products. 5.
